Job Summary of the MRI Technologist The MRI Technologist shall be responsible for performing MRI - Magnetic Resonance Imaging procedures in accordance with standards and practice set forth by the Medical Director of Radiology and Department Policies and Procedures. Provides training for Level One MR Safety Trained Personnel. The MRI Technologist demonstrates a knowledge of the human structure and functions, patient care, positioning, principles of electromagnetic and computer sciences, magnetic protection and specialized techniques. Applies appropriate patient care and recognizes patient conditions essential for successful completion of the procedure. MRI Technologist will also perform duties of Medical Radiographer when not performing MRI exams. Responsibilities of the MRI Technologist
Demonstrate excellence by consistently producing MRI images of diagnostic quality on patients ranging from Neonatal to Geriatric.
Follow established scanning protocols and operate the MRI scanner and related equipment efficiently and effectively.
Complete quality scans in a timely manner, effectively organizes and prioritizes workflow to meet STAT and urgent demands.
Demonstrate proficiency in scanning trauma, acute & challenging patients; possess skill to modify positioning and scanning factors when standard cannot be performed.
Possess knowledge of disease processes and image these findings adequately; communicate them to the Radiologist.
Demonstrate accountability for clinical responsibilities and safety practices in the MR department.
Qualifications of the MRI Technologist
EDUCATION:
Graduate of an America Medical Association-approved program in Radiologic Technology
Completion of courses in MRI - Magnetic Resonance Imaging and cross-sectional anatomy
EXPERIENCE:
One year of experience performing MRI - Magnetic Resonance Imaging procedures
LICENSES & CERTIFICATIONS REQUIRED:
Certified in Radiology by the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ists - ARRT (R) or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(RDMS) by the Association of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onography (ARDMS)
MRI post-primary certifications required 1 year post MRI assignment
Basic Cardiac Life Support must be obtained within 30 days of employment start date
